Hopkinsville, KY – September is National Preparedness Month, but Regional Citizen's Corps throughout Kentucky work to keep residents prepared for disasters year round. A citizen's corps is a group of volunteers overseen by a region's development district. They respond in emergencies and provide disaster training and information. This year, many districts saw a drop in state funding for their corps, but a few, including the Pennryile Area Development District, got a boost.
